Exclamation Do Not put DVD in NAV!

"Warning DO NOT PUT DVD IN NAV! "

This is what i was told by my stealer.. nice man he was, untill he took all my money! ha. He said "if you put a regular dvd into the NAV system because it has DVD written on it. It wont work.. and it will cause damage to the NAV drive. Will cost £2000 to fix! "

dont tend to belive what salesman say.. anyone tried it??
If he didnt mention it.. am sure i would have given it a go!

But i aint risking it.. anyone want to give it a go... "at your own risk?"

whats your views on what the salesman said!
